Sat 796030531582604

decimal
159206.531582604
degree
0°159206′1958″531582604‴
percentile
37.90621583134467%
name
ifdfpkwizaj
cycle
0
epoch
0
period
78
block
159206
offset
531582604
timestamp
rarity
common